DR 212 - Tool Design

Credit Hours: 3
Contact Hours: 4
Prerequisites/Other Requirements: DR 150 

English Prerequisites: None

Math Prerequisites: None

Corequisites: None
Description: This course teaches the design of jigs, fixtures, and gages. A special emphasis is placed on machining fixtures. Specification of standard parts, raw materials, fabricated details, and critical dimensions are included in this course.  It is recommended that students have used drafting and 3D modeling software prior to taking this course.
